PIP: In the course of 15 years, there were about 220 juvenile mothers (i.e., .75%) out of a total of 29,188 at the authors' hospital. The social structure of parents has remained unchanged. The frequency of complications among juvenile mothers did not exceed the average for the entire group and there have been no more complicated cases. The frequency of operational deliveries among juvenile mothers has been considerably lower (1.46%) and the percentage of large fetuses has been lower as well. The frequency of breech deliveries was higher than the clinical average.^ieng

PIP: From 1954 to 1968 there were 29,188 deliveries at the II. Gynecologic-obstetrics Hospital in Bratislava. During separate 5-year periods a change came about in the age-group structure, chiefly in the parity. The most striking decrease is that of the frequency of women who delivered more than 2 children. Comparing the duration of deliveries in the years 1954 and 1968, there was a reduction from 16 hours 19 minutes to 11 hours 3 minutes in the case of primiparas and from 9 hours 45 minutes to 7 hours 12 minutes in the case of multiparas. The frequency of protracted labors decreased considerably.^ieng
